The Collaborative CME and Research Network (CCRN) is a not-for-profit physician organization that develops and provides impactful and evidence-based continuing medical education for healthcare professionals. We develop accredited and non-accredited continuing medical education focusing on improving the future of health care delivery across all therapeutic areas. CCRN members can benefit from exclu

sive access to our resource library and preferential invitations to research and practice assessment programs, and discounts with vendor partners in travel, entertainment, and retail.
